Job Description
Key Responsibilities:
Develop and maintain project-level integration roadmaps spanning development, contracting, project finance, execution, and Commercial Operation. Support Project Managers by identifying cross-functional risks, decision gaps, and interdependencies early, enabling timely intervention and escalation. Facilitate clear communication of roles, responsibilities, and requirements across internal teams and external partners, allowing the achievement of defined project timelines. Track progress against the integration roadmap across Project Management, internal departments, and external counterparties. Integrate, track, and manage requirements and schedule across key agreements, including PPAs, interconnection agreements, financing, EPC contracts, owner-supplied equipment, and market readiness. Support the integration of all project requirements and deliverables into LRE systems so that they can be successfully performed and tracked. Surface recurring risks and systemic issues across projects to inform continuous improvement and execution predictability, highlight process gaps and work with the respective LRE SME to correct any deficiencies.
